Identifying Common Plumbing and Electrical Issues in Homes

Identifying common plumbing and electrical issues is an essential aspect of home repair and maintenance. Over time, these systems age and wear out, leading to a range of problems that can impact both comfort and safety. According to recent data, about 25% of homes in the U.S. experience significant plumbing issues annually, while electrical problems are even more prevalent, affecting approximately 38% of households. These statistics underscore the importance of proactive maintenance.
One common plumbing issue is a leaking faucet or pipe. Such leaks can waste up to 20 gallons of water per day, leading to substantial water bills and potential damage from water intrusion. Another frequent problem is a clogged drain, which can be addressed through regular cleaning and the use of enzyme-based cleaners. For homes with older plumbing systems, corrosion and mineral buildup in pipes are not uncommon, causing reduced water flow and potentially leading to more severe issues.
In the realm of electrical systems, overloaded circuits, faulty wiring, and outdated fuseboxes are frequent culprits. Overloaded circuits can cause lights to flicker or blow fuses, while faulty wiring may lead to electrical fires—a stark reminder of the critical nature of proper installation and maintenance. Regularly inspecting electrical panels for signs of damage or corrosion is crucial, as is ensuring that all appliances and fixtures adhere to modern safety standards. Homeowners should also be vigilant about replacing old, fragile bulbs with energy-efficient LED alternatives to reduce heat buildup and extend the lifespan of wiring.
Diagnosing Problems: Tools and Techniques for Home Repair

When tackling home repair and maintenance, especially complex issues within plumbing and electrical systems, accurate problem diagnosis is paramount. Experts in these fields employ a multifaceted approach, leveraging both advanced tools and time-honored techniques to identify and rectify problems efficiently. This process often involves meticulous observation, comprehensive inspections, and the strategic use of diagnostic equipment.
For plumbing repairs, professionals start by isolating the problem area through visual inspection, checking for leaks, clogs, or corrosion. Specialized tools like pressure gauges, flow meters, and digital multimeters are then employed to measure water pressure, detect electrical faults in fixtures, and identify blockages in pipes. For instance, a pressure gauge can pinpoint issues within the plumbing system, whether it’s low water pressure caused by a leaky faucet or an overworked pump. Similarly, electrical experts use voltage testers and amperometers to assess wiring integrity, identify faulty connections, and locate overloaded circuits, ensuring safety and efficacy in home repair and maintenance.
Beyond these tools, experts rely on their extensive knowledge of systems design and common failure points. They may employ non-invasive techniques like thermal imaging cameras to detect electrical hotspots or use sound waves to pinpoint pipe leaks. These advanced methods not only expedite diagnosis but also minimize damage during the repair process. By combining these diverse approaches, plumbing and electrical experts deliver precise solutions tailored to each unique home repair scenario.
Effective Maintenance: Preventive Care for Plumbing and Electrical Systems

Preventive care is a cornerstone of effective maintenance for both plumbing and electrical systems, offering homeowners significant long-term benefits. Regular inspections, often recommended by industry experts, can identify potential issues before they escalate into costly repairs or safety hazards. For instance, a routine check on plumbing fixtures may reveal signs of corrosion in older pipes, allowing for timely replacement and preventing leaks that could cause extensive water damage. Similarly, electrical systems benefit from periodic assessments to ensure wiring integrity and detect potential risks like frayed connections or outdated components.
Homeowners can actively contribute to preventive maintenance through simple yet impactful practices. Regular cleaning of drain pipes and gutters prevents clogs and ensures proper water flow, reducing the risk of flooding and related damages. Keeping electrical panels free from debris and ensuring clear ventilation minimizes the likelihood of overheating and potential fires. Additionally, staying informed about modern efficiency standards for appliances and fixtures can guide homeowners in making updates that not only enhance performance but also reduce energy consumption, ultimately contributing to cost savings in home repair and maintenance over time.
Data supports the efficacy of preventive care: studies show that proactive measures can reduce the frequency of system failures by up to 30%. This translates into significant savings for homeowners and less disruption to daily life. Moreover, regular maintenance can extend the lifespan of both plumbing and electrical systems, making them more resilient against aging and environmental factors. By embracing a culture of preventive care, homeowners can enjoy increased peace of mind, knowing their properties are well-maintained and safe.
